Eligibility - Population(s) Served
Adults 18 years and older * resident of Ontario * verified physical or mental disability that is expected to last a year or more * disability must make it difficult for applicant to care for him/herself, go into the community or to work

Description of Services:
The Ontario Disability Support Program (ODSP) is intended to meet the needs of people with disabilities and help them to become more independent * ODSP provides financial assistance to people with disabilities * Amount of benefit depends on size of family, shelter costs, income, and assets
